python输出unicode字符 文心快码BaiduComate 在Python中输出Unicode字符是一个相对直接的过程,以下是根据你的提示给出的详细解答: 理解Unicode字符的概念: Unicode是一种字符编码标准,它为世界上所有的书写系统中的每个字符分配了一个唯一的数字代码,即码点(code point)。这样,无论是中文、英文还是其他语言的字符,都...
Python是一门强大的编程语言,它支持Unicode字符的输出和处理。我们可以使用\u加上Unicode编码或者chr()函数来输出Unicode字符,使用字符串类型来处理Unicode字符。Unicode字符和UTF-8编码是两个不同的概念,Unicode字符用于表示字符,UTF-8编码用于将字符转换成计算机可读的二进制数据。在Python中,我们可以使用字符串类型来处...
所以总的思路是出现'\\uxxxx'的字符串,首相通过一种常规的字符编码方式utf8 gbc随便你,转换成b'\\uxxxx'的形式,然后再通过'unicode_escape'的编码解码,变成'\uxxxx'的形式,在Python中'\uxxxx'就应该显式一个具体的unicode字符。 整个解释说完了,要是还没看懂,我也不知道如何解释。
unicode=ord(char) 1. 这段代码中,ord()函数会将输入字符char转换为其对应的Unicode编码,并将结果赋值给变量unicode。 步骤3:输出编码结果 最后,我们可以使用print()函数将编码结果输出。print()函数用于在控制台输出指定的内容。下面是代码示例: print("字符",char,"的Unicode编码是",unicode) 1. 这段代码中,...
Python可以使用`chr()`函数来输出Unicode对应的字符。语法格式:```pythonchr(unicode)```示例:```pythonprint(chr(65)) # 输出:Aprint(chr(8364)) # 输出:€```注意:在Python 2中,`chr()`函数的参数应该是一个整数类型的Unicode编码值,而在Python 3中,`chr()`函数的参数可以是整数或者字符编码的字符...
在Python中,可以使用`chr()`函数来输出Unicode对应的字符。`chr()`函数接受一个整数参数,该参数表示Unicode编码的值,然后返回对应的字符。以下是一个示例:```python...
2.X Python官方IDLE的BUG 2.X官方的IDLE有个很严重的BUG:即使你显式定义一个Unicode字符(准确地说是对象),他居然也会用系统ANSI编码来存储,而不是Unicode。 1 2 3 4 5 6 7 8 9 10 11 12 >>>importsys >>>importlocale >>> sys.getdefaultencoding() ...
在Python中,可以通过使用encode和decode方法来去除输出中的Unicode字符。 Unicode是一种字符编码标准,它包含了世界上几乎所有的字符,包括各种语言的字符、符号和表情等。当我们在Python中打印字符串时,如果字符串中包含Unicode字符,它们会以\uXXXX的形式显示出来。
命令行提示符下,python print输出unicode字符时出现以下 UnicodeEncodeError: 'gbk' codec can't encode character '\u30fb 不能输出 unicode 字符,程序中断。 解决方法: sys.stdout = io.TextIOWrapper(sys.stdout.buffer, errors = 'replace', line_buffering = True)...
近期在学习Python语言,为了巩固学习的质量,特设计一个程序作为强化练习。程序的需求是这样的,要实现如下图所示,根据用户输入unicode name检索并列出系统内置的unicode码表,需要运用到的库unicodedata,以及str.format()字符串格式化处理知识点。 (图1) 一、首先我们要在程序的头部引入相关的库: ...